  • Oracle 10g Real Time Backup

    Hi
    My company need to set database real time backup for Oracle 10g release 2 (Standard Edition).
    I see in Oracle Database 10g Product Family [Oracle Database 10g Product Family|http://www.oracle.com/technology/products/database/oracle10g/pdf/twp_general_10gdb_product_family.pdf] not support the Data Guard.
    Can I do it in Oracle 10g SE ?
    Thanks in advance

    hi,
    trouble is the cost of EE can be quite expensive
    another way of creating a psuedo (hope I spelt that correctly) dataguard would be to script a method of shipping archive files to a DR server.
    Live System
    =========
                 BEGIN
              IF ORACLE ONLINE THEN
                            SWITCH LOG;
                       END IF;
                       IF ANOTHER INSTANCE OF SCRIPT RUNNING (LOCAL OR REMOTE) THEN
                                 ERROR;
                                 EXIT;
                       END IF;
              IF (STANDBY NOT ONLINE) THEN
                              ERROR;
                              SEND EMAIL;
                              EXIT;
                       END IF;
                       GET LAST SHIPPED LOG FILE TIMESTAMP FROM THE REMOTE SITE OR FROM LOCAL SERVER;
                        WHILE LOG > SHIPPED LOG FILE TIMESTAMP DO
                                  TRANSFER LOG FILE TO REMOTE SITE;
                                  DO CHECKSUM ON LOG FILES;
                                  IF NOT MATCH THEN
                                         RETRY TRANSFER;
                                         IF FAILURE 3 TIME THEN
                                               ERROR;
                                               SEND EMAIL;
                                         END IF;
                          END IF;
                                  ' GOT THIS FAR SO ALL IS OK
                                  MARK THE LOG FILE AS TRANSFERRED;
                        WEND;        
    DR System
    ========
              BEGIN
                   CREATE A LOCK SEMAPHORE;        - Only one instance allowed
                                 CHECK LAST APPLIED LOG FILE;
                   IF CONNECTION TO LIVE SERVER OK THEN
                                         CHECKSUM  NEXT LOG FILE WITH LIVE SYSTEM;
                                         IF CHECKSUM NOT SAME THEN
                                                  IF LOG FILE ON ITS WAY FROM LIVE THEN
                                                           EXIT;
                                                  END IF;
                                                  WHILE  LOGFILE EXISTS DO
                                                            GET NEXT LOG FILE FROM LIVE;
                                                  WEND;
                                         END IF;
                                 ELSE
                                         ' Extra work
                                         APPLY NEXT LOG FILE
                                 END IF;
                   APPLY LOG FILES;
                                 WORKOUT NO OF LOG FILE APPLIED;
                                 KEEP SPECIFIED PERCENTAGE LOG FILES;
                                 DELETE EXTRA LOG FILES;
                                 TRANSFER LAST APPLIED LOG FILE ATTRIBUTES TO LIVE SERVER;
                                 EXIT;
                         END;       I cannot give you the actual code that I have as there are some more bits that I have added for our client but what it does is give you an over view of the process involved for creating a pseudo DG environment.

  • How to include Date for backup of Oracle in a script !!! LINUX

    hi,
    I need to add date & time for the backup of Oracle 10g on OEL 5 32 bit.
    and also how do I get an email when Rman finishes its job
    Thanks in advanced.

    user584721 wrote:
    Thanks for the update..
    I am using a script called full_dpbackup.sh which contain the following ...
    expdp system/oracle schemas=scott directory=test_dir dumpfile=scott.dmp logfile=expdpscott.log mpencryption=all encryption_password=scott reuse_dumpfiles=y compression=all
    I need to include the date & time in this script.
    Thanks in advanced.That's not a backup, it's an export.
    I don't have my linux system handy to debug, but what you want would be something like:
    expdp ..... dumpfile=exp_`date`.logThe reverse single quote (I don't know the official term, but it's the character just to the left of the one/exclamation on a US keyboard) tells the shell to substitute the value returned by the command enclosed by the marks. In the example above, it would substitute the value returned by the "date" command. That command has many, many arguments to control the format of what is returned. Look them up an any good nix reference, or just "man date".  (As for any good nix reference, you should at a minimum have a copy of "Unix In A Nutshell" on your desk.)

  • Problem with Oracle 10g Enterprise Manager DB control scheduled backup

    Hi
    DB is - Oracle Database 10g Enterprise edition-10.2.0.1.0
    OS is - Windows Server 2003, Enterprise edition, Service Pack - 2
    I have scheduled daily backup from DB control, some backup didn't completed.
    Status of backup was - "Suspended on Agent Unreachable"
    While try scheduling new backup job from DB control, it is giving error.
    Error - Connection to host as user <user_name> failed: IOException in sending Request :: Connection refused: connect
    Anyone has any clue regarding this? please help.

    Hi,
    Have a read of this thread which talks about the same issue and its solution.
    Oracle 10g EM DB console Host Preferred Credentials for Windows
    And if you are finding issues in the entering the Host credentials itself, you may need to log on as batch job. Follow thiese steps,
    +1. Go to control panel/administrative tools+
    a. click on "local security policy"
    b. click on "local policies"
    c. click on "user rights assignments"
    d. double click on "log on as a batch job"
    e. click on "add" and add the user that was entered in the "normal username" or "privileged username" section of the EM Console.
    +2. Go to the Preferences link in the EM GUI+
    a. click on Preferred Credentials (link on the left menu)
    b. under "Target Type: Host" click on "set credentials"
    c. enter the OS user who has logon as a batch job privilege into the "normal username" and "normal password" fields
    +3. Test the connection+
    a. while in the Set Credentials window, click on "Test"
    From http://www.orafaq.com/forum/t/89472/0/
